🔥 CREAMY HARISSA BUTTER BEANS WITH CRISPY HALLOUMI & HOT HONEY 🔥

Golden crumbed halloumi sits over creamy harissa butter beans, finished with fresh herbs, quick-pickled onion and a generous drizzle of our Australian Black Lime Hot Honey. The sweet heat and deep citrus flavour bring the whole dish together beautifully.
Serves 4
INGREDIENTS
For the beans:
• 2 tbsp olive oil
• 1 brown onion, finely diced
• 3 garlic cloves, crushed
• 2 tbsp rose harissa paste
• 2 × 400g tins butter beans, drained
• 150g Greek yoghurt
• 2 tbsp hot water
• 1 tbsp lemon juice
• Salt and pepper
For the crispy halloumi:
• 250g halloumi
• 2 tbsp cornflour
• 1 egg, beaten
• 1 cup panko breadcrumbs—or gluten-free breadcrumbs
• Olive oil for frying
For the quick-pickled onion:
• 1 red onion, very thinly sliced
• ½ cup white wine vinegar or apple cider vinegar
• 1 tbsp caster sugar
• ½ tsp Australian Black Lime Pepper—optional, but delicious
TO FINISH
• Australian Black Lime Hot Honey
• Fresh mint
• Dill, parsley or coriander
• Quick-pickled onion
• A little extra harissa mixed with olive oil
METHOD
1. Combine the pickled-onion ingredients and set aside.
2. Cook the brown onion gently until soft and lightly caramelised. Add the garlic and cook for another minute.
3. Add the butter beans and harissa paste. Cook for 2–3 minutes, until warmed through.
4. Whisk together the Greek yoghurt, hot water and lemon juice until smooth.
5. Reduce the heat to low and gently fold the yoghurt mixture through the beans. Warm without boiling, then season to taste.
6. Coat the halloumi in cornflour, beaten egg and breadcrumbs. Fry in olive oil until beautifully golden and crispy.
7. Spoon the creamy beans into bowls and top with crispy halloumi, fresh herbs and pickled onion. Finish with extra harissa oil and a generous drizzle of Australian Black Lime Hot Honey.
